Hazardous materials
A Class C commercial driver's license allows drivers to operate single vehicles or combination vehicles that do not meet the criteria of Class A or Class Kup prawo jazdy kategorii B bez egzaminu licenses. This license permits drivers to drive passenger vehicles that can accommodate more than 16 passengers, including the driver. It also allows drivers to operate vehicles that transport hazardous materials. These drivers must pass a knowledge exam and undergo special training to earn an endorsement on their CDL.
The endorsement H gives truckers to operate a vehicle that transports hazardous materials in placardable quantities. The endorsement can only be valid when all the conditions are met, which includes that the quantity of hazardous material transported is within DOT limits and that the material has been properly classified and labeled, and both the cargo and the vehicle meet safety regulations. Additionally, a hazmat employee must go through specialized training to ensure that the proper precautions are employed when transporting these materials.
In addition to the H endorsement, there are a number of other endorsements that can be added to the CDL. The N endorsement permits drivers to operate tanker vehicles that transport sometimes volatile liquids and gasses. The driver must pass a test to prove their understanding of specific fields in order to obtain this endorsement. The T endorsement permits drivers to operate double or triple trailers, which require additional knowledge and skills. The X endorsement requires truckers to pass another niche knowledge test to operate tanker vehicles that transport explosive materials.
A representative of the motor driver or the carrier must be present at all times when driving a motor vehicle that is carrying Division 1.1,1.2, or1.3 materials. This applies to interstate and intrastate transport as well as to shipments and vehicles carrying hazardous materials.
The hazmat endorsement is not available to truck drivers who only drive for local delivery services. Drivers must have at least two years' driving experience to be eligible for this endorsement. They also need to be in good health, have a clean driving record, and pass a physical test. Additionally, they must pass a background check and drug test. Drivers who do not comply with these requirements could be subject to fines or even lose their CDL.

In the United States, a person who wants to operate commercial motor vehicles (CMV) must obtain an official driver's license in class C. A class C driver's license enables drivers to drive trucks and trailers with a Gross Vehicle Weight rating of less than 26001 pounds. The driver can also transport 16 or more passengers including the driver. Based on the state, it may also include a hazmat endorsement or a passenger or school bus endorsement.
Some of the most common trailers and trucks that require the class C CDL are straight trucks as well as dump trucks. Certain drivers require this license to operate small passenger buses and vans. Other vehicles that are able to be operated with a class C CDL include tanks, buses and double or triple trailers.
You must pass a knowledge test and a vision screening test before you can be granted a Class C license. Then, you have to pass a medical examination with an accredited doctor. The doctor will determine if you're fit to drive a CMV. He will then issue an official medical certificate which you must submit to the CDL office to get your license.
You must also pass a written test in order to receive an endorsement on a specific vehicle. An endorsement is a CDL add-on that allows you to operate a certain type of vehicle or carry a specific cargo. There are many different types of endorsements. Some of the most popular include P - Passenger Vehicle, T - Triple trailers, Double/Triple N - Tank Vehicle, and Hazard material.
